Four Sterling Silver Salvers
Various makers, 20th century
Each shaped square, three raised on four feet. 10 inches to 10 1/2 inches, square, total approximately 95 ounces.

Additional Notes & Condition Report

All generally good condition overall; light surface marking and scratching as expected from normal use; some small scattered pin pint dents; good heavy gauge; clearly hallmarked

No feet - Tiffany & Co., Birmingham, 1955 - 10 1/4 in. (26 cm)
Peter Guille, London, 1952 - 10 in. (26 cm)
Crichton, London, 1921 - 10 1/4 in. (26 cm)
Crichton, London, 1929 (Britannia standard) - 10 1/2 in. (26.3 cm) - engraved crest to center
